New recipes out every week

Best Broccoli Salad

Best Broccoli Salad

This Broccoli Salad is Creamy, Crunchy & Crowd-Pleasing

If you’re looking for a fresh, crunchy side dish that disappears fast at any gathering, this Best Broccoli Salad is it. Packed with crisp broccoli, smoky bacon, sweet cranberries, and a creamy tangy dressing, this recipe is simple to prep and even better after it chills.

It’s the perfect make-ahead salad for potlucks, BBQs, family dinners, or weekly meal prep.


Why You’ll Love This Broccoli Salad

  • ✔ Perfect balance of creamy, crunchy, sweet & savory

  • ✔ Easy to make ahead

  • ✔ Customizable (keto-friendly options included)

  • ✔ No cooking required (except bacon!)

  • ✔ Great for gatherings or weekday lunches


Ingredients You’ll Need

Salad Base

  • 1⅓–1½ lbs fresh broccoli florets, bite-sized

  • 8 slices cooked bacon, chopped

  • ⅓ cup finely diced red onion

  • ½ cup sweetened dried cranberries (or keto substitute)

  • ⅓ cup sliced or slivered almonds

Creamy Dressing

  • 1 cup mayonnaise

  • 3 tbsp apple cider vinegar

  • 1½ tbsp granulated sugar (or substitute)

  • ¼ tsp freshly ground black pepper

Optional Add-Ins

  • 1 cup shredded sharp cheddar

  • ½ cup sunflower seeds


How to Make the Best Broccoli Salad

STEP 1: Make the Dressing

In a medium bowl, whisk together mayonnaise, apple cider vinegar, sugar, and black pepper until smooth and creamy.

https://images.getrecipekit.com/20260209143406-unnamed.jpg?aspect_ratio=1%3A1&quality=90

STEP 2: Combine the Salad Ingredients

In a large mixing bowl, add broccoli florets, chopped bacon, red onion, cranberries, and almonds.

STEP 3: Toss It Together

Pour the dressing over the salad and toss thoroughly until everything is evenly coated.

https://www.allrecipes.com/thmb/EHm83d1KLfageR5j1gP7Xd1ryek%3D/1500x0/filters%3Ano_upscale%28%29%3Amax_bytes%28150000%29%3Astrip_icc%28%29/8725179_Broccoli-Crunch-Salad_Debbie-Hendrix_4x3-2a9e35259e064feb8f0e4f1e9f6475b3.jpg

STEP 4: Chill for Best Flavor

Cover and refrigerate for at least 1–2 hours. This allows the flavors to blend beautifully and slightly tenderizes the broccoli.

Before serving, give it one final toss.


Tips for the Best Flavor & Texture

✔ Cut broccoli small. Bite-sized pieces make it easier to eat and help the dressing coat evenly.

✔ Chill time matters. Don’t skip it! The flavor deepens and the texture improves after resting.

✔ Balance sweetness. Adjust sugar depending on how sweet your cranberries are.

✔ Toast the almonds. For extra flavor, lightly toast almonds before adding.


Variations & Substitutions

  • Keto Version: Use sugar substitute and unsweetened dried cranberries.

  • Nut-Free: Swap almonds for sunflower seeds.

  • Extra Protein: Add shredded rotisserie chicken.

  • Cheesy Upgrade: Stir in sharp cheddar for extra richness.


Storage Tips

Store in an airtight container in the refrigerator for up to 3 days. Stir before serving as dressing may settle slightly.


What to Serve with Broccoli Salad

This salad pairs beautifully with:

  • Grilled chicken

  • Burgers

  • BBQ ribs

  • Pulled pork

  • Sandwich platters

It’s also hearty enough to enjoy on its own for a light lunch.


Make-Ahead Friendly

This is actually one of those salads that tastes better the next day, making it ideal for entertaining or weekly meal prep.


I’m Jessica, your new guide. Welcome to my Cookbook!

Hi, I’m Jessica—busy mum, food lover, and the voice behind this blog. I create simple, wholesome recipes that bring joy to the table without taking hours in the kitchen.

Latest Recipes
Subscribe

Subscribe to our newsletter and be informed about new recipes & workshops.

Loading